Participants: allORFEUS/KNMI, INGV (IT), NERC(UK), UIB(NO), GFZ(GE), NIEP(RO),

ETHZ(CH), VUA(NL), IMO(IC), TUBITAK(TU), CSIC(ES), IST(PO), NOA(GR), UU(SE), PAS(PO), UCPH(DK), ASCR(CZ)

Objectives:- Providing outreach and dissemination- Identifying further potential downstream users- Promoting the EPOS Research Infrastructures- Develop capacity building through specific training initiatives- Assessment of EPOS impact on stakeholders and users

Categories of stakeholders:i) National Research Organisations & funding agenciesii) EPOS data providers [WG’s in WP6]iii) EPOS (RI) data users (including Academia)iv) Data and services providers and users

outside the research community (including industry)

WP 8: Stakeholder interaction and dissemination

WP 8: Deliverables and Milestones.

Deliverables: D8.1 – Web portal and user interfaces [M6/12/…/48]D8.2 – Brokerage events with stakeholders at national and European level [M18/36]D8.3 – Impact validation through web services [M24/36/48]D8.4 – Editorial promotion activities [M24/48]D8.5 – Report on dissemination activities [M36/48]D8.6 – Report on stakeholder interactions [M36/48]

Milestones:MS37 – web dynamic overview stakeholders [M6]MS38 – appointment P&U commission [M6]MS39 – WP8 and stakeholder meetings at EGU [8, annual]MS40 – EPOS information booth at EGU [8, annual]MS41 – Stakeholder category (iv) meeting [24, ??]MS42 – P&U commission meeting [18/24/36]MS43 – Stakeholder category (ii) meeting [36]MS44 – Outreach meeting all participants [18/30]
